Even for us, the intrepid travelers, the fall of 2000 saw us going a bit more far afield than usual.  While Bangkok, Phuket and Chiang Mai may be on many-a-traveler's southeast Asia itinerary, we went a bit further a field as well.  NE Thailand, centered around Udon Thani and Nam Kai, brought us face to face with local Thailand, not the sanitized world of the typical tourist spots.  Crossing the border to Laos, we got more off the beaten track in our visits to the laid-back capital of Vientiane, the more laid-back temple town of Luang Prabang, and onward to the still-more-laid-back journey up the Mekong River. And then there was Chuck's pre-Thai/Laos journey to the Himalayan mountain kingdom of Bhutan, an extraordinary destination in anyone's book.
